Red Dead Redemption publisher president defends lockboxes
November 30, 2017 80 comments
http://massivelyop.com/2017/11/30/red-dead-redemption-publisher-president-defends-lockboxes/
Not everyone in the video game industry is shying away from lockboxes or denouncing them outright. Take-Two Interactive President Karl Slatoff took the side of the ESA by saying that he doesnt consider lockboxes gambling and that the Red Dead Redemption 2 studio will continue using microtransactions going forward.
The whole gambling regulator thing, we dont view that sort of thing as gambling. Our view of it is the same as the ESA statement for the most part, Slatoff said during a recent confererence. Thats going to play its course, but in terms of the consumer and the noise you hear in the market right now, its all about content [ ] You cant force the consumer to do anything. You try to do your best to create the best experience you possibly can to drive engagement. And driving engagement creates value in entertainment. Thats just how its always been and always will be.
